Ingredients
85g Corn Flour
85g Plain Flour
2 tsp Black Pepper
2 tsp Szechuan Peppercorns
For frying Sunflower Oil
400g Squid
Sliced Spring Onions
Sliced Green Chilli
1 chopped Red Chilli
1/2 Cucumber
1 chopped Red Onions
100 ml Rice Vinegar
1 tablespoon Caster Sugar
2 tsp Fish Sauce
Instructions
1
step 1
To make the dipping coulis, combine all the components in a small container until the granulated sugar has dissolved, then set aside.
2
combine the cornflour and plain baking flour with both peppers and 2 tsp sea table salt in a large container, then set aside.
3
Line a tray with kitchen paper and make sure you have more table salt to scatter with.
4
step 2
fiery up about 7cm of fat to 180C in a deep fryer, wok or deep pot.
5
If you don’t have a thermometer, you can test it with a cube of bread – it should brown in 20 secs.
6
Coat the squid well with the baking flour combine and sauté in batches for about 2 mins each or until crisp.
7
Use a slotted spoon to lift out the squid, then empty out on the kitchen paper and scatter with a little more table salt.
8
present the squid scattered with the spring bulb greens and chilli, with the dipping coulis on the side.
